Teliphone Corp. acquires Navigata

telecom | 12/07/2012 9:23 pm EST

Toronto network operator Teliphone Corp. acquired Navigata Communications 2009 Inc.’s core assets, operations and network, the company said. “The transaction includes all core assets, operations and network of Navigata Communications 2009 Inc. including its British Columbia wireless microwave backhaul network, its Canadian Wavelength Fibre Optic Network, CLEC Operations, and its mutual CLEC/ILEC co-location facilities,” the company said in a release Monday. The subsidiary will now operate under the brand name Teliphone Navigata-Westel and Navigata will change its name to Cascade Divide Enterprises Inc., the release said. The company said Benoit Laliberte, Teliphone’s chief technology officer, has been appointed as president and CEO of Teliphone and Teliphone Navigata-Westel. Outgoing president and CEO Lawry Trevor-Deutsch will continue to serve within the company as a special adviser for business development, the release said....
